达梦数据库备份实操
1、冷备份演示进入dmdba用户,进入$DM_HOME/tool目录中,这里需要注意的是,在使用库备份等数据库冷备时,需要将数据库实例关闭,启动DmAOService服务;
执行dmservice.sh,打开DM服务查看器,设置DmServiceDMSERVER为停止状态;
(1)在tool目录下启动达梦控制台工具console,命令:./console
此时,我们就可以通过新建备份来完成DM8的完全备份;
(2)我们也可以使用dmrman进行数据库备份;进入DM8安装目录bin中,执行dmrman,进行数据备份;命令:./dmrman;
一定要注意,在线备份热备开始前,dmap服务是打开的,数据库实例是打开的,数据库是归档模式;那么如何打开归档呢? DM8中可以通过两种方式打开归档模式;(1)命令方式
(2)图形界面方式打开DM8-manager图形界面,进入管理服务器
选中“系统管理”,将数据库状态转换成“配置”状态;
选中“归档配置”,将数据库归档模式选中为“归档”,并添加归档日志路径和文件大小,点击确定即可完成归档打开;
开归档后请将数据库状态转换成打开状态。
(3)利用管理工具做热备
(4)命令行热备(全备,增量备份)使用disql进行全备
使用disql进行增量备份
数据恢复数据库恢复时,需要先将DM8实例处于mount状态,关闭实例服务这里我们使用dmrman恢复数据
校验备份集
(1)还原表空间
(2)恢复表空间
(3)重启实例完成恢复
3.1 逻辑备份DM8逻辑备份使用导入和导出的方式(dexp dimp)分成四级备份数据库级别用户模式表级
(1)逻辑导出进入$DM_HOME/bin,使用dexp命令使用逻辑导出
命令如下:
./dexp sysdba/Admin1234@localhost:5236 file=dexp20201202.dmp log=dexp20201202.log directory=/dmdata/ full=y
(2)逻辑导入
./dimp sysdata/Admin1234@localhost:5236 file=/dmdata/dexp20201202.dmp log=/dmdata/dexp20201202.log
3.2 作业自动备份除了手动或添加计划任务进行数据库备份外,还可以使用DM8管理工具中的作业对备份进行定制化的策略;
(1)创建作业代理环境在manager管理界面上选中作业创建作业代理环境;
(2)新建作业
新建作业调度
备注:增量备份同理,注意备份方式选择。实际操作中,请注意根据试题要求进行名称及备份方式选择,同时备份路径也需要明确,若由于备份路径错误,将不得分。
文章
阅读量
获赞